What is a shotblaster?

A shotblaster, also known as a shot blasting machine or a shot peening machine, is a piece of equipment used for cleaning, strengthening, or preparing surfaces. shotblasters use steel shot, a type of abrasive material, to propel at high speeds onto a surface using centrifugal force. This process effectively removes surface contaminants, old coatings, and prepares the surface for new coatings or overlays.

How does a shotblaster work?

shotblasters work by using centrifugal force to propel steel shot at high speeds onto a surface. The steel shot impacts the surface, removing contaminants, old coatings, and roughening the surface to improve adhesion of new coatings. The steel shot used in shotblasters comes in various shapes and sizes, allowing for flexibility in surface preparation applications.

Uses of shotblasters

shotblasters are used in a wide range of industries and applications for surface preparation. Some common uses of shotblasters include:

– Concrete surface preparation: Shotblasters are commonly used in the concrete industry to remove surface contaminants, old coatings, and prepare concrete surfaces for new coatings or overlays. Shotblasting is an effective method for creating a rough profile on concrete surfaces, improving adhesion of coatings and overlays.

– Steel surface preparation: Shotblasters are also used in the steel industry for cleaning and strengthening steel surfaces. Shotblasting is an efficient method for removing rust, scale, and other contaminants from steel surfaces, preparing them for painting, coating, or welding.

– Aerospace industry: Shot peening, a process similar to shotblasting, is commonly used in the aerospace industry to strengthen and improve the fatigue life of metal components. Shot peening helps to create compressive stresses on the surface of metal components, enhancing their resistance to fatigue failure.
